Development of Customized Microfluidc Devices

Design and development of customized microfluidic devices and perfusion-based experimental setups for specialized research applications.

ISO 10993 Testing Using Microfluidic & Organ-on-Chip Models

Biocompatibility, cytotoxicity, and drug response testing under dynamic perfusion using microfluidic and organ-on-chip models for physiologically relevant evaluation.

3D Tissue Models for Drug Testing

Development of spheroids, organoids, and 3D tissue models to create physiologically relevant in vitro systems for drug toxicity, efficacy testing, and disease modeling.

Consultation and Collaboration

Consultation on the design and development of customized microfluidic and organ-on-chip systems for pharmaceutical drug validation, disease modeling, and specialized research applications.
